Manisha Juthani is a Professor of Medicine and Infectious Diseases physician at Yale School of Medicine with a secondary appointment as Professor in Epidemiology of Microbial Diseases at the Yale School of Public Health. She has held leadership roles including Infectious Diseases Fellowship Program Director since 2012 and has been instrumental in leading infectious disease efforts at Yale during the COVID-19 pandemic.

Dr. Juthani's research focuses on improving the diagnosis, management, and prevention of infections in older adults, particularly urinary tract infections and pneumonia in nursing home settings. Her work bridges infectious diseases, geriatrics, and palliative care, with significant contributions to antimicrobial stewardship at the end of life. She has conducted federally funded research including a landmark JAMA publication on cranberry capsules for UTI prevention in nursing homes.
Her recent publications demonstrate a clear focus on antibiotic use in vulnerable populations, particularly older adults with advanced cancer transitioning to end-of-life care. The research examines the delicate balance between infection management and quality of life, with implications for antimicrobial stewardship in palliative settings. Her work spans clinical trials, observational studies, and educational interventions aimed at improving urine culture practices and antibiotic use.

As Infectious Diseases Fellowship Program Director since 2012, Dr. Juthani has mentored numerous trainees in infectious diseases. Her research has been supported by federal funding, including an R01 grant that led to her influential JAMA publication. During the pandemic, she has been featured extensively in national media outlets including CNN, The New York Times, and BBC News Hour. Her work at the intersection of infectious diseases and palliative care represents a growing field with significant implications for end-of-life care practices.
